Web28 feb. 2024 · To delete OCSP and/or CRL cache from your Windows system: Go to Start Menu > Run. Type cmd and press Enter. Enter the following command and press Enter to execute: certutil -urlcache * delete. Mac OS X. Note: After clearing the cache, you need to restart your computer for the changes to take effect. WebIn the Keychain Access app on your Mac, choose File > Add Keychain. Select the deleted keychain file. You can also open the Keychain file in the Finder or, if you use Time Machine to back up your files, you can restore the file with Time Machine. Keychains are usually located in the Keychains folder in the Library folder in your home folder.
